As You may not know by default:
  • Normal signals: colored stripe on the pole has a break (ie. the red or yellow stripe has a white paint-on)
  • PBS signals: colored stripe doesn't have break

(G)(R)(Y) - Standard signal (on Red-White-Red pole)
(R)(G) - Exit signal (on Red-White-Red pole)
(G)(Y) - Entrance signal (on Yellow-White-Yellow pole)
(W)(W)(G)(Y) - Combo signal (on Yellow-White-Yellow pole)

Key: (G) Green light (R) Red light (Y) Yellow light (W) Lunar white light
Ordered from top to bottom
